Part Overview

The 3M 1-6-1126 is an RF EMI shielding tape constructed from copper foil with conductive, single-sided adhesive. This product is designed for electromagnetic interference (EMI) shielding applications requiring reliable RF attenuation in electronic assemblies. Key Parameters

Parameter Value
Manufacturer Part Number 1-6-1126
Manufacturer 3M
Series 1126
Type Shielding Tape
Material Copper Foil
Width 1.000" (25.40 mm)
Thickness 0.004" (0.09 mm)
Length 18.000' (5.50 m)
Adhesive Type Conductive, Single Sided
Operating Temperature Range -40°C to 130°C
Product Status Active
RoHS Status ROHS3 Compliant

Engineering Selection Recommendations

Both the 3M 1-6-1126 and 3M 1126 X 1" are active production parts with ROHS3 compliance certification. Selection between these variants is determined by application length requirements rather than functional performance differences. The 1-6-1126 provides 18 feet of tape per unit, while the 1126 X 1" variant supplies 108 feet per unit. For applications requiring extended continuous shielding coverage, the higher-capacity variant reduces the number of individual tape units required. Both parts maintain identical electrical conductivity, thermal performance, and adhesive characteristics across the specified operating temperature range of -40°C to 130°C.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Can the 3M 1126 X 1" substitute for the 3M 1-6-1126 in the same application?

A: Yes. Both parts share identical material composition, width, thickness, adhesive type, and operating temperature specifications. The only difference is tape length per unit. Substitution is valid when application requirements can accommodate the longer tape length variant.

Q: What is the primary difference between these two parts?

A: The 3M 1-6-1126 contains 18 feet of tape, while the 3M 1126 X 1" contains 108 feet of tape. All other specifications—copper foil material, 1-inch width, 0.004-inch thickness, conductive single-sided adhesive, and -40°C to 130°C operating range—are identical.

Q: Are both parts ROHS3 compliant?

A: Yes. Both the 3M 1-6-1126 and 3M 1126 X 1" meet ROHS3 compliance requirements.

Q: What storage conditions are required for these shielding tapes?

A: Both parts require storage at 50°F to 80°F (10°C to 27°C) with a 60-month shelf life from the date of manufacture.

Q: Can these tapes be used in high-temperature environments?

A: Yes. Both variants are rated for continuous operation from -40°C to 130°C, making them suitable for standard industrial and commercial temperature ranges.
